(13.8.1) R 3 C − X + 2 Li → R 3 C − Li + LiX. A Grignard Reagent. (13.8.2) R 3 C − X + Mg → R 3 C − MgX. An Organocuprate Reagent. Halide reactivity in these reactions increases in the order: Cl < Br < I and Fluorides are usually not used. The alkyl magnesium halides described in the second reaction are ...

The formation of a Grignard reagent usually takes place in an anhydrous ethereal solution between magnesium metal and either an aryl or an alkyl halide. In these reactions, the electophillic carbon on the halide bonds with the magnesium and becomes a nucleophillic carbon.
